Enderby Wharf

  • Reference: 2018/1324
  • Question by: Caroline Pidgeon
  • Meeting date: 21 June 2018
Following your welcome statement on the 22 May 2018 urging the Royal Borough of Greenwich "to do the right thing" over Enderby Wharf in relation to the use of on shore power, please provide an update on what meetings or correspondence you have had with the new leader of Greenwich Council on this matter.

Garden Bridge

  • Reference: 2018/1323
  • Question by: Caroline Pidgeon
  • Meeting date: 21 June 2018
Can you ensure Transport for London (TfL) provides a clear explanation as to why the Garden Bridge Trust minutes from December 2015 record that TfL would 'struggle' to justify the release of £7 million to the Garden Bridge Trust, yet by February 2016 TfL had agreed to release the funding? Can you ensure TfL finally sets out in detail its reasons for releasing the £7 million tranche of funding at this date?

Transport for London Bus Safety Programme - Updating Contracts to Include Safety Performance Targets

  • Reference: 2018/1318
  • Question by: Caroline Pidgeon
  • Meeting date: 21 June 2018
The previous Mayor announced on 1 February 2016 that TfL bus contracts would be updated "within three months". What is preventing Transport for London (TfL) from updating contracts to include safety performance targets in all bus contracts?
